Most of the important recommendations of the vehicle manufacturer on preventive maintenance, diagnostic and car repair procedures are written in the vehicles owners manual. This material is therefore a very vital reference needed in complying strictly with the frequency and schedule of maintenance procedures. It is expected that a vehicle owner will read the manual thoroughly and keep it within easy reach but safe. It can be photocopied for added protection and it would be beneficial to provide the mechanic who is regularly taking care of the vehicle with a copy. Vehicles that are older will probably be required by a responsible mechanic to undergo more frequent preventive maintenance procedures.

Vehicle owners themselves should however shoulder the responsibility of being alert and observant on signs of trouble in the vehicle. If the owner is watchful, problems can be detected early enough to prevent costlier repairs.

The ground or garage floor underneath the vehicle should be checked by the vehicle owner every day. If there are puddles or wet spots found, the color of the liquid should be determined. Clear liquid is safe because it is most likely from the vehicle air conditioners condensation. Colored liquid could provide clues on vehicular problems, though. An overheated engine or leakage of the anti-freeze can produce blue, orange or yellow green liquid. Leakage of the transmission fluid or power steering fluid can produce red liquid.
